Window and Dome Technologies and Materials II | 1990

Enhancement in aerothermal shock survivability of lanthana-strengthened yttria windows and domes

George C. Wei; Marina R. Pascucci; E. A. Trickett; S. Natansohn; William H. Rhodes

Experiments aimed at improving the physical properties of transparent polycrystalline lanthanastrengthened yttria (LSY) infrared windows and domes were conducted. The objective was to enhance the thermal shock resistance for aggressive aerothermal environments. The approach included improving the average equibiaxial flexure strength, Weibull modulus, and other relevant physical properties. Initial results of an extensive study on polishing and post-fabrication treatment along with improved powder processing showed an -30% strength improvement without sacrifice in optical properties, leading to an appreciable increase in the calculated survivability. LSY with a low lanthana content significantly enhanced predicted survivability.


Window and Dome Technologies and Materials III | 1992

Scattering in lanthana-strengthened-yttria infrared transmitting material

George C. Wei; Arlene Hecker; William H. Rhodes

Lanthana-strengthened yttria (LSY) is a window and dome material for 3 - 5 micrometers IR applications. Scattering, an important optical property of LSY, was measured using a scatterometer method and integrating sphere technique. The scatterometer results were correlated with the integrating sphere results. The mechanisms of forward scattering in LSY are discussed.
